Ethereum's Merge and its Influence on BTC
The recent upgrading of the Ethereum blockchain to a proof-of-stake consensus mechanism, known as "The Merge," has sparked considerable debate within the copyright community about its potential influence on the price of Bitcoin. Some analysts suggest that the Merge could decrease competition from Ethereum, potentially boosting investor interest towards Bitcoin as the dominant copyright. Others opine that the Merge's success will have a minimal impact on Bitcoin's price, citing its established market position and unique characteristics.
Nevertheless, it's important to recognize that the copyright market is highly unpredictable, making it difficult to accurately forecast price movements. The Merge's long-term outcomes on Bitcoin remain indeterminate. Further study is needed to completely assess the complex relationship between these two leading cryptocurrencies.

Bitcoin Halving: Preparing for the Next Bull Run
The anticipated Bitcoin halving is a major event in the copyright space. It's a programmed reduction in the amount at which new Bitcoins are mined. This {scheduled{ event typically promotes a price rally, as availability becomes more constrained. Traders and investors anticipate this halving cycle to affect Bitcoin's value.
